Summary

Only a small fraction of entrepreneurs lead their enterprises to  a successful reality. But, sadly, even if their enterprise does  become successful, they can still fail when their companies  succeed. As the enterprise becomes more successful, the boards of  directors and other stakeholders want to see that business succeed  in the futureand they dont usually see that future  with the founding entrepreneur leading the way.  It happened to Steve Jobs. It has happened to thousands of other  entrepreneurs and it can happen to youunless you learn how  to be more than just an entrepreneur and more than just a leader.  In order to avoid their mistakes you need to walk the walk of an  Entrepreneurial Leader, right on the razors edge.  Being an Entrepreneurial Leader is more than just being an  entrepreneur plus leader.  Entrepreneurs have  certain needs, wants, and desires for their companies. But so do  the people who make up that enterprise. Its difficult for  founding entrepreneurs to make room for others thoughts,  concerns, opinions, and desires when it comes to their  babies. Why? Because entrepreneurship is a fundamentally  selfish act. You began your company because you wanted to be your  own boss. Most of your motivations for starting the business were  about you. And running a company in this mode of thinking  ultimately leads to failure. Leadership, on the other hand, is  about selflessness and making those around you feel they will be  successful. A leader can take a team of individuals with differing  wants, needs, and visions and get everyone on the same page. A  leader makes everyone feel like they are being heard, are  appreciated, and are winning.  But to be a successful entrepreneur, you cant just be the  selfless commander-in-chief. In order for you to be successful and  grow with your enterprise you must somehow balance the two opposing  natures of the entrepreneur and the leader. In Startup  Leadership entrepreneur and professor Derek Lidow describes the  narrow boundary between these two opposing domains and provides you  with the skills and tools to become an Entrepreneurial Leader.  Based on Lidows popular and well-respected class  Entrepreneurial Leadership, Startup Leadership distills  Lidows insights gained from his experience and others who  have struggled as entrepreneurs and leadersas well as from  extensive researchto present the best practices for growing  with the company you created.  It provides the tools needed to  avoid the unseen traps most entrepreneurs fall victim to and needed  to achieve the delicate balancing act that all Entrepreneurial  Leaders must perform in order to successfully lead their team,  enterprise, and themselves to lasting success.
